SubjectRe: [PATCH v4 8/8] bus: mhi: core: Ensure non-zero session or sequence ID values are used
On 2020-05-04 07:33, Jeffrey Hugo wrote:
> On 5/1/2020 8:32 PM, Bhaumik Bhatt wrote:
>> While writing any sequence or session identifiers, it is possible that
>> the host could write a zero value, whereas only non-zero values should
>> be supported writes to those registers. Ensure that the host does not
>> write a non-zero value for them and also log them in debug messages.

> I don't think this math works. For example, if MHI_RANDOM_U32_NONZERO
> is 0x0FF0, and BHIE_RXVECSTATUS_SEQNUM_BMSK is 0xF, then sequence_id
> will end up being 0.

In this case, SEQNUM BMSK is set to 0x3FFFFFFF so this change will still
work as
we only supplied a non-zero number macro to AND with the mask.
However, I agree that may not be the case always that we would know the
bitmask
in advance so it is better to fix it for good.

Thanks for the catch! I have updated the change to have the macro take
the
bitmask as a parameter and output a non-zero value.
